Solution for 3=-6u-3 equation:


Simplifying
3 = -6u + -3

Reorder the terms:
3 = -3 + -6u

Solving
3 = -3 + -6u

Solving for variable 'u'.

Move all terms containing u to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'6u' to each side of the equation.
3 + 6u = -3 + -6u + 6u

Combine like terms: -6u + 6u = 0
3 + 6u = -3 + 0
3 + 6u = -3

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-3 + 6u = -3 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+ 6u = -3 + -3
6u = -3 + -3

Combine like terms: -3 + -3 = -6
6u = -6

Divide each side by '6'.
u = -1

Simplifying
u = -1
